Exports by Country

Germany (X tons) was the main destination for peach and nectarine exports from Italy, accounting for a X% share of total exports. Moreover, peach and nectarine exports to Germany exceeded the volume sent to the second major destination, Austria (X tons), fourfold. The UK (X tons) ranked third in terms of total exports with a X% share.

From 2012 to 2022, the average annual rate of growth in terms of volume to Germany totaled X%. Exports to the other major destinations recorded the following average annual rates of exports growth: Austria (X% per year) and the UK (X% per year).

In value terms, Germany ($X) remains the key foreign market for peaches and nectarines exports from Italy, comprising X% of total exports. The second position in the ranking was held by Austria ($X), with a X% share of total exports. It was followed by the UK, with a X% share.

From 2012 to 2022, the average annual rate of growth in terms of value to Germany amounted to X%. Exports to the other major destinations recorded the following average annual rates of exports growth: Austria (X% per year) and the UK (X% per year).

Imports by Country

In 2022, Spain (X tons) constituted the largest peach and nectarine supplier to Italy, accounting for a X% share of total imports. Moreover, peach and nectarine imports from Spain exceeded the figures recorded by the second-largest supplier, France (X tons), sevenfold. The third position in this ranking was taken by Greece (X tons), with a X% share.

From 2012 to 2022, the average annual rate of growth in terms of volume from Spain was relatively modest. The remaining supplying countries recorded the following average annual rates of imports growth: France (X% per year) and Greece (X% per year).

In value terms, Spain ($X) constituted the largest supplier of peaches and nectarines to Italy, comprising X% of total imports. The second position in the ranking was held by France ($X), with an X% share of total imports. It was followed by Germany, with a X% share.

From 2012 to 2022, the average annual rate of growth in terms of value from Spain stood at X%. The remaining supplying countries recorded the following average annual rates of imports growth: France (X% per year) and Germany (X% per year).

China remains the largest peach and nectarine consuming country worldwide, comprising approx. 61% of total volume. Moreover, peach and nectarine consumption in China exceeded the figures recorded by the second-largest consumer, Italy, more than tenfold. The third position in this ranking was taken by Spain, with a 3.3% share.
China remains the largest peach and nectarine producing country worldwide, comprising approx. 60% of total volume. Moreover, peach and nectarine production in China exceeded the figures recorded by the second-largest producer, Spain, more than tenfold. Italy ranked third in terms of total production with a 4.3% share.
In value terms, Spain constituted the largest supplier of peaches and nectarines to Italy, comprising 78% of total imports. The second position in the ranking was taken by France, with an 11% share of total imports. It was followed by Germany, with a 4.6% share.
In value terms, Germany remains the key foreign market for peaches and nectarines exports from Italy, comprising 39% of total exports. The second position in the ranking was taken by Austria, with a 9.9% share of total exports. It was followed by the UK, with a 6.6% share.
In 2022, the average peach and nectarine export price amounted to $1,412 per ton, falling by -15.9% against the previous year.
The average peach and nectarine import price stood at $1,604 per ton in 2022, growing by 13% against the previous year.
